Zen Carbon is seeking a Control & Automation Lead to architect implement and scale the automation backbone of our mineralization reactors. This role will transition our systems from partially manual operation to fully instrumented PLC-based control architectures integrating process control MRV carbon accounting and deployable digital MRV (dMRV) frameworks.
You will own:
PLC system architecture for next-generation mineralization reactors
Real-time process monitoring and control
Sensor and actuator integration
Data acquisition and infrastructure design
Reaction-state inference from sensor signals
Failure detection and diagnostics
Scalable dMRV-ready infrastructure
What Success Looks Like (7 Months)
Fully deployed PLC architecture for next-gen mineralization reactor
Instrumentation framework with defined uncertainty budgets
Automated carbon accounting pipeline
dMRV-ready infrastructure
Documented FMEA and diagnostics framework
Scale-ready automation blueprint
Requirements
2 years in industrial automation or process control
Deep PLC experience (Siemens TIA Portal Rockwell etc.)
Experience in chemical cement gas handling or process industries
Strong knowledge of PID control and industrial instrumentation
Familiarity with SCADA and industrial communication protocols (OPC-UA Modbus)
